Abstract

PROBLEM TO BE SOLVED: To cover the outer periphery of the junction end part of a frame material made of a metallic mold material for protection, and safely finish in good appearance. SOLUTION: A frame material 3 made of a metallic mold material is arranged in a cabinet 1 along the inner periphery of a rectangular opening part 2, each frame material 3 is installed along the inner circumference corner of the cabinet 1, and the end parts of each frame material 3 are jointed together at the cornet part of the rectangular opening part 2 with each other. Then a synthetic resin corner member 4 is installed on the outer periphery of the end part of both frame members 3 located at the junction part.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a frame material joining structure provided on an inner peripheral portion of a frame of panels used for door panels, partition panels and the like.

Description of the Related Art Conventionally, as shown in FIGS. 5 and 6, a frame material (c) made of a metal mold material is provided along each inner side of a rectangular opening (b) in a frame (a). Then, each frame material (c) is installed along the inner peripheral corner of the surface of the frame (a), and the ends of each frame material (c) are butted and joined at the corners of the rectangular opening (b). The following frame material joining structure is known.

In the frame material joining structure, the frame (a) is made of wood, the frame material (c) is formed of a hollow extruded aluminum material, and the frame material (c) is made of the frame (a). It is fixed to the inner peripheral angle portion of the surface. In addition, a pair of frame members (c) arranged on both sides of the frame body (a) sandwiches the peripheral edge portion of the face body (d) fitted in the rectangular opening (b) of the frame body (a). And the face piece (d) is a glass plate.

However, in the above-mentioned conventional technique, the end portion of the frame material (C) made of metal mold material which is butted and joined at the corner portion of the rectangular opening (B) is exposed, There is a risk of injury by catching a finger, hand, arm or the like on the outer peripheral surface of the end portion, and a step is generated on the outer peripheral surface of the end portion, resulting in poor appearance.

The present invention has been invented to solve the above-mentioned problems in the prior art. That is, the problem is that the outer peripheral surface of the butt joint end of the frame member made of metal mold is covered and protected. And to provide a frame material joint structure that is safe and has a good appearance.

In the frame material joining structure according to claim 1 of the present invention, a frame material made of a metal mold material is arranged along each inner peripheral side of a rectangular opening in a frame, The frame material is provided along the inner peripheral corner of the surface of the frame, and the end portions of each frame material are butt-joined at the corners of the rectangular opening, and the outer peripheral surface of the end portions of both frame members at the butt joint is A corner member made of synthetic resin is attached and attached. Therefore, the outer peripheral surface of the butt joint end of the frame member made of a metal mold member is covered by the corner member made of synthetic resin, and the outer peripheral surface of the butt joint end of the frame member is protected and is not exposed and is safe, The same frame material is butt-joined to each other to prevent the positional displacement between the ends, and the appearance is also excellently finished.

A frame material joining structure according to a second aspect of the present invention is the frame material joining structure according to the first aspect, wherein the corner member is formed to have a substantially L-shaped cross section, and the vertical side portion of the corner member is a frame member. It is characterized in that the lateral side portion of the corner member is sandwiched and fixed between the back surface of the frame member and the front surface of the frame body. Therefore, in this case, in particular, the corner member formed to have a substantially L-shaped cross section is hard to bend and becomes strong, and the lateral side portion of the corner member is firmly fixed so as not to come off.

The frame material joining structure according to a third aspect of the present invention is the frame material joining structure according to the second aspect, in which a convex piece portion that is bent outward is formed at the tip of the lateral side portion of the corner member. The convex piece portion is engaged with a concave groove portion formed on the back surface of the frame member. Therefore, in this case, in particular, the convex piece of the corner member is locked in the concave groove portion of the back surface of the frame member, and the corner member is more reliably fixed so as not to come off and move easily. The positional displacement between the butt joint ends is more reliably prevented, and the appearance is improved.

The frame material joining structure according to claim 4 of the present invention is the frame material joining structure according to claim 2 or 3, wherein a substantially triangular notch is formed in the middle of the lateral side portion of the corner member. It is characterized in that the middle part of the remaining vertical side portion is a bendable portion. Therefore, in this case, in particular, by bending the corner member at the bendable portion at an appropriate angle, it is possible to deal with the case where the end portions of the frame member are butt-joined at different angles.

A frame material joining structure according to a fifth aspect of the present invention is characterized in that, in the frame material joining structure according to the fourth aspect, the apex angle of the notch portion adjacent to the vertical side portion is formed as an obtuse angle. . Therefore, in this case, in particular, by bending the corner member at the bendable portion at an angle of a right angle or more, it is possible to cope with the case where the ends of the frame material are butt-joined at an angle of a right angle or more. it can.

1 and 2 show the first aspect of the present invention.
5 shows an embodiment corresponding to Nos. 5 to 5, in which the frame member joining structure is configured such that the frame member 3 made of a metal mold member is arranged along each inner side of the rectangular opening 2 in the frame 1. , Each frame member 3 is provided along the inner peripheral corner of the surface of the frame 1, and the end portions of each frame member 3 are butted and joined at the corners of the rectangular opening 2.
The corner members 4 made of synthetic resin are attached and attached to the outer peripheral surfaces of the end portions of both frame members 3 at the butt joints.

In this embodiment, the corner member 4 is formed to have a substantially L-shaped cross section, the vertical side portion 5 of the corner member 4 is provided along the outer peripheral surface of the frame member 3, and the lateral side portion of the corner member 4 is provided. 6 is sandwiched and fixed between the back surface of the frame member 3 and the front surface of the frame 1. Further, a convex piece portion 7 bent to the front side is formed at the tip of the lateral side portion 6 of the corner member 4, and the convex piece portion 7 is engaged with a concave groove portion 8 formed on the back surface of the frame member 3. There is. or,
As shown in FIG. 3, a substantially triangular notch 9 is formed in the middle of the lateral side portion 6 of the corner member 4, and the middle of the remaining vertical side portion 5 is a foldable portion 10. In this case, the apex angle 11 of the cutout portion 9 adjacent to the vertical side portion 5 is formed as an obtuse angle.

The frame 1 is made of wood, and a glass plate 12 is fitted in a rectangular opening 2 having a vertically long rectangular shape to form a door panel. The frame material 3 is formed of a hollow extruded aluminum material, and the frame material 3 is formed to have a substantially L-shaped cross section as a whole, and its inner corner portion is fixed to an inner peripheral angle portion of the surface of the frame 1. . In this case, the lower hole 13 is formed in the inner side wall portion of the frame member 3, and the fixing hole 14 is formed in the outer side wall portion thereof.
The fixing screw 15 is inserted into the fixing hole 14 from 13 and the fixing screw 15
By being screwed into the inner peripheral surface of the frame body 1, the same frame members 3 are fixed to the surface inner peripheral angle portions on both sides of the frame body 1, respectively. In addition, in the lower hole 13, after the frame material 3 is fixed,
A synthetic resin cap body 16 that closes 13 is fitted and fixed.

Further, a pair of frame members 3 arranged on both sides of the frame 1 hold a peripheral portion of a glass plate 12 fitted in a rectangular opening 2 of the frame 1. In this case, the soft packing material 18 is provided in the groove portion 17 formed in the frame material 3.
Are fitted and held, and the soft packing material 18 is brought into contact with both front and back sides of the glass plate 12, so that the glass plate 12 is securely clamped without rattling.

The corner member 4 is obtained by forming a notch 9 having an apex angle 11 of 90 degrees or more by performing post-processing such as cutting and cutting on a mold material integrally extruded from synthetic resin. Has been formed. The corner member 4 may be integrally formed of synthetic resin by injection molding.
